Шаблоны для сайтов в системе uCoz
Главная » Файлы » Книги, журналы

Сикорд Р.С. - Безопасное программирование на C и C++, 2-е издание (2015)
03.06.2020, 08:34

Узнайте об основных причинах уязвимостей программного обеспечения и научитесь их избегать! Распространенные уязвимости программного обеспечения обычно вызываются дефектами программирования, которых можно было бы избежать. Проанализировав десятки тысяч сообщений об уязвимостях, начиная с 1988 года, CERT выявила, что подавляющее количество уязвимостей вызывается относительно небольшим количеством первопричин.
Во втором издании книги Безопасное программирование на C и C++ выявляются и поясняются эти первопричины и указываются шаги, которые могут быть предприняты для устранения уязвимостей в разрабатываемом программном обеспечении. Кроме того, книга призывает программистов принять на вооружение наилучшие методы обеспечения безопасности и выработать образ мышления, который может помочь защитить программное обеспечение не только от известных на сегодня, но и от будущих атак. Опираясь на доклады и выводы CERT, Роберт С. Сикорд систематически указывает программные ошибки, которые скорее всего приведут к нарушениям безопасности, показывает, как они могут быть использованы злоумышленниками, рассматривает потенциальные следствия такого использования и предоставляет безопасные альтернативы.
В книге подробно рассмотрены следующие темы:
Повышение безопасности и защищенности любого приложения на C/C++.
Описание атак с использованием переполнения буфера и разрушения стека, использующих небезопасную логику работы со строками.
Как избежать уязвимостей и дефектов безопасности при использовании функций управления динамической памятью.
Как устранить проблемы целочисленной арифметики, вытекающие из переполнения знаковых целых чисел, циклического возврата беззнаковых целых чисел и ошибок усечения.
Безопасный ввод-вывод и устранение уязвимостей, связанных с файловой системой.
Корректное применение функций форматированного вывода без внесения уязвимостей форматных строк.
Устранение конфликтов при доступе к ресурсам и прочих уязвимостей при разработке параллельно выполняемого кода.


Название: Безопасное программирование на C и C++, 2-е издание
Автор: Сикорд Р.С.
Год: 2015
Жанр: программирование
Издательство: Вильямс
Язык: Русский

Формат: pdf
Качество: Отсканированные страницы + слой распознанного текста
Страниц: 498
Размер: 13 MB
Скачать Сикорд Р.С. - Безопасное программирование на C и C++, 2-е издание (2015)

Скачать файл можно после просмотра рекламы:

Категория: Книги, журналы | Добавил: didl3
Просмотров: 19 | Загрузок: 0 | Рейтинг: 0.0/0
Sony Vegas...
Sony Vegas...
5. VKontak...
5. VKontak...
Навител На...
Навител На...
MPC HomeCi...
MPC HomeCi...
Auslogics ...
Auslogics ...
Всего комментариев: 0
Ты оставишь комментарий первым!
Добавлять комментарии могут только зарегистрированные пользователи.
[ Регистрация | Вход ]
На сайте* выкладываются все новинки игр,софта,музыки,фильмов,клипов и материалы другого типа
Наш Soft-mofS.ru не содержит никакой нелегальной информации, только хеш-суммы файлов свободно доступных в сети.
Владельцы сайта не могут нести ответственности за действия пользователей. Этот ресурс полностью анонимный - IP адреса и действия пользователей не сохраняются. Сайт не предоставляет электронные версии произведений, а занимается индексированием файлов, находящихся в файлообменных сетях, Все права на произведения принадлежат правообладателям. Если вы являетесь правообладателем произведения, проиндексированного нашей поисковой машиной и не желаете чтобы ссылка на него находилась в нашем каталоге, ознакомьтесь с правилами нашего ресурса на этой странице , свяжитесь с нами через форму обратной связи и мы незамедлительно удалим её. Публикация материалов сайта возможна только с разрешения администрации.